Discover the charm and potential of this traditional two-bedroom detached house located in the scenic Algarve, in Faro, Portugal. While this house maintains a classic Algarve style, it boasts an unobstructed sea view that adds to its allure. Constructed before 1951, history whispers through the walls of this verdant 4720 m² south-facing plot, largely fenced and offering substantial privacy and space.

The property itself covers a modest 53 m² but is cleverly laid out to maximize every inch. The home includes two bedrooms, a large bathroom, a functional kitchen, a storage room, and a comfortable living room that leads out to a spacious outdoor terrace equipped with a barbecue – perfect for enjoying Faro's beautiful weather. An attached garage of 35 m² provides ample space for vehicles or can be transformed into additional living or recreational space.

Although renovated a few years ago, it would benefit from some modern touches, offering a fantastic opportunity for those looking to imprint their personal style in their new home. The 320 m² of urban surface area within the plot allows for up to 300 m² of additional construction subject to local planning regulations, presenting a remarkable chance for expansion or even potentially developing a small project.
